ALEXANDRIA, Va., Feb. 12 -- United States Patent no. 12,223,319, issued on Feb. 11, was assigned to OnSpecta Inc. (Redwood City, Calif.).

"Microkernel-based software optimization of neural networks" was invented by Victor Jakubiuk (San Francisco) and Sebastian Kaczor (Poznan, Poland).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"Disclosed are systems and methods related to providing for the optimized software implementations of artificial intelligence ("AI") networks. The system receives operations ("ops") consisting of a set of instructions to be performed within an AI network.
